    WILLIAMS: The endless wars of Islam

    Islam emerged from what is modern-day Saudi Arabia in the seventh century, and never looked back.
    Muslim armies swept across North Africa and invaded Catholic Spain, destroying or converting the Christian communities along the way. They turned churches into mosques and made Islam the official religion. Muslim armies also took over the Holy Land, destroyed the last non-Islamic Persian empire, and moved into Asia Minor (modern-day Turkey). By the 16th century, Islam had destroyed the Christian Byzantine Empire, had taken over Constantinople and had turned the Hagia Sophia — the most beautiful church in Christendom — into a mosque. A century later, Muslim armies were outside the gates of Vienna, Austria.
